Bacon and Rotel Cups

Ingredients

  • 45 mini phyllo shells, thawed (3 packages)
  • 1 can mild Rotel, drained almost all the way
  • 1 cup bacon, cooked and crumbled
  • 1½ cups Colby jack cheese, shredded
  • 1 cup mayonnaise

Steps

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Place phyllo shells on a baking sheet lined with a silicone mat or parchment paper.
  2. In a large bowl, mix together the Rotel, bacon, and mayonnaise until blended.
  3. Add in the cheese and stir until completely mixed together.
  4. Fill the phyllo shells with the bacon/Rotel mixture.
  5. Bake for 30 to 35 minutes. Remove from the oven and serve warm or at room temperature.

From the margins

  • Can use tortilla chips to make gf — bake 6 min.
  • The original recipe said to bake for 15–20 minutes, so you can start checking them then. 30–35 works great and gets them nice and crispy.
